PHPackages                             syan/validator -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Validation &amp; Sanitization](/categories/validation)
4. /
5. syan/validator

ActiveLibrary[Validation &amp; Sanitization](/categories/validation)

syan/validator
==============

Validator

v3.0.3(4y ago)0112↓100%Apache-2.0PHPPHP &gt;=7.0.0

Since Dec 27Pushed 11mo agoCompare

[ Source](https://github.com/SyanH/validator)[ Packagist](https://packagist.org/packages/syan/validator)[ Docs](https://openmix.org/mix-php)[ RSS](/packages/syan-validator/feed)WikiDiscussions master Synced 1mo ago

READMEChangelogDependencies (2)Versions (22)Used By (0)

> OpenMix 出品：[https://openmix.org](https://openmix.org/mix-php)

Mix Validator
=============

[](#mix-validator)

Validator based on PSR-7 standard

基于 PSR-7 标准的验证器

Installation
------------

[](#installation)

```
composer require mix/validator

```

创建表单
----

[](#创建表单)

继承 `Mix\Validator\Validator` 并定义：

- `public $name` 字段名
- `rules()` 验证规则
- `scenarios()` 验证场景
- `messages()` 错误消息

```
